Yes that is one of the things I am still thinking about if and how I would implement that.
Because a natural T10 with T7 would directly work. A T7 with T1 T1 woudl work with a rune of discovery.
But a T7 with T2 T2 and empty affix slot would just work as well, you just need to craft twice and hope no crit happens.
But those are incomaptible with one singular rule, so this would lead to making multiple rules for one specific crafting case, which needs explaining. And having a rule that needs in-depth explanations is not useful for the most users that are using my Filter anyway.
This is the eternal struggle of a One-Size-Fits all format, you simply can’t do it. I can only try to get as close as possible while remaining useful without any further setup requriements.
